Are grizzly bears and Alaskan brown bears the same? Brown/Grizzly Bears Those that live in coastal areas of Alaska are called brown bears, while typically inland bears that have limited or no access to marine-derived food resources are often smaller and called grizzlies. What is a trench lighter? The trench lighter was a piece of equipment every soldier carried in WWI and WWII. These lighters were built from the used brass bullet casings in the field. Does pertussis increase cAMP levels? pertussis, CyaA inhibits host adenylate cyclase, resulting in accumulation of cyclic adenosine monophosphate (cAMP); elevated levels of cAMP within phagocytic cells inhibit oxidative activity and induce apoptosis, thus disabling this arm of the immune system.
